This is a rough, high-level estimate built on general industry benchmarks for firms of different sizes. It is not a valuation, it is not an appraisal, it is not an offer, and nothing here is binding on anyone.
What your firm is actually worth depends on things no calculator can see: how much of the work runs through you personally, how long your clients have been with you and how concentrated they are, your pricing relative to the market, the mix of recurring versus seasonal work, the strength and tenure of your team, your systems, your lease, your margins' durability, and plenty more. Two firms with identical revenue and identical margins can be worth materially different amounts, and often are.
